在Ubuntu中,使用别名(alias)可以简化命令行操作,提高效率。如果你遇到了关于别名的问题,请按照以下步骤进行排查和解决:
alias
命令,查看已设置的别名列表。如果你的别名没有出现在列表中,请检查你的别名设置是否正确。通常,别名可以在~/.bashrc
(针对Bash shell)或~/.zshrc
(针对Zsh shell)文件中设置。例如,要为ls -la
命令设置别名ll
,你可以在配置文件中添加以下内容:alias ll='ls -la'
然后保存文件并运行source ~/.bashrc
(或source ~/.zshrc
)使更改生效。
别名冲突:如果你的别名与系统命令或其他程序冲突,可能会导致问题。请检查你的别名设置,确保它们不会与其他命令冲突。如果有冲突,请更改别名名称。
别名未生效:如果你在新的终端窗口中输入别名命令,但它没有生效,请确保你已经保存了配置文件并重新加载了它。你可以使用source ~/.bashrc
(或source ~/.zshrc
)命令重新加载配置文件。
检查语法错误:请检查你的别名设置是否有语法错误。正确的语法应该是alias 别名='命令'
。
检查shell类型:请确保你正在使用的shell支持别名功能。大多数Linux发行版默认使用Bash shell,但有些发行版可能使用其他shell,如Zsh或Fish。你可以使用echo $SHELL
命令查看当前使用的shell。
如果以上步骤都无法解决问题,请提供更多关于你的问题的详细信息,以便我能更好地帮助你。